David Kyte Doyle (8 December 1931 – 8 May 2021) was a lieutenant general in the United States Army who served as Assistant Chief of Staff for Information Management.[1] An alumnus of the University of Maryland, he was commissioned following completion of Officer Candidate School. Doyle received a B.S. degree in military science from the University of Maryland, an M.S. degree in international relations from George Washington University and a Master of Military Arts and Sciences degree from the U.S. Army Command and General Staff College.[2]
